About the role

  • Conduct analysis on pay and performance, identify trends, present findings to senior HR and business leaders
  • Consult with HR Partners and senior business managers on pay decisions and related challenges
  • Serve as an advocate of compensation philosophy and HR Partners and recruiters on how to apply to their businesses
  • Study market trends; report findings and recommendations to team
  • Support the annual merit, bonus, and equity allocation processes which include assisting in the allocation of funding, defining, and delivering training to users, and reviewing salary increase recommendations against guidelines to highlight discrepancies
  • Continuously improve through development of tools and streamlining processes to increase efficiency of compensation planning efforts, analytics
  • Assist with analysis of sales compensation plans and strategic plan design innovations

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ree preferred
  • 4-7 years of relevant work experience
  • Previous experience in a consultative compensation role with an analytical basis
  • Proficiency in communicating complicated concepts to a broad audience
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ills (e.g. ability to write complex dynamic formulas, charts, and dashboards)
  • Proficient in Microsoft PowerPoint
  • Ability to maintain discretion with extremely confidential information
  • Ability to build trust-based relationships with HR Partners and management
  • Strong organizational, analytical, and written communication skills
  • Ability to build a story with data to support business decisions and recommendations
